This striking print captures a fascinating glimpse into the world of modern armaments in 1938. Titled "Old and New Field Dress," this image showcases the evolution of military attire during a time of rapid technological advancement.
The photograph, taken by an English Photographer, is part of a set of cigarette cards on the subject of Modern Armaments issued by Louis Gerard in 1938. It depicts two soldiers side by side, one clad in traditional uniform from years past and the other outfitted in more contemporary gear. The contrast between old and new is stark, highlighting the changing nature of warfare during this period.
